Package: backupninja
Version: 1.0.1-1
Severity: minor

Hi.

/usr/share/doc/backupninja/examples/example.rdiff proposes some values for 
exclusions in /home/* but the rdiff helper has many more.

I think it would be more consistent to have the 2 aligned on same options, by 
default.
